, AKI S/S oliguria;decreased urine output; azotomia;
fluid overload signs- crackles, edema, confusion, low spO2 (88), tachycardia; Map
below 65
AKI in xray dx infiltration (fluid in lungs)
AKI ABG results may read respiratory alkalosis (spao2 below 88%)
example of pre renal AKI dehydration, blood loss, decreased cardiac output, heart failure; infection; NG
suction, sepsis, V/D
Example of intra renal AKI myoglobinuria,BPH, tubular necrosis, nephrotoxocity; acute polynephtiits,
contrast
Example of post renal AKI bladder neck obstruction, bladder cancer; calculi; tumor
Duiretic phase (3rd phase) of AKI Nurse should give 3L-6L per day; place Foley
Asses I and O (output=1000-2000mL/day)
replace fluids and monitor electrolyes
dialysis may be required
Best Lab indicator of Kindey function (AKI and CKD) creatine (Normal 0.6-1.2)
AKI increased 1-2 every 24-48hrs
Normal urine output per hour 30 mL/hr
normal potassium levels 3.5-5.0 mEq/L
Normal Sodium levels 135-145 mEq/L
Diet for AKI patients mod protein
high carb
